Abstract :
The performance results of the adaptive DPCM speech codecs which have been used in conjunction with an Adaptive Frequency Mapping system (AFMAP) are presented. The AFMAP preprocessor operates on a wideband speech (0.3 - 7.6 KHz) and compresses the speech signal into 0.3 - 3.3 KHz telephone channel. This signal is subsequently digitized by DPCM codecs employing simple, but efficient prediction algorithms in order to reproduce wideband speech from AFMAP postprocessor output. The informal listening tests, SNRSEG measures indicate that AFMAP system in tandem with DPCM codecs significantly enhances the recovered speech compared to other bandwidth compression systems. The reproduced AFMAP speech is also preferable to 0.3 - 3.3 KHz telephone speech, digitized by the some codecs at the same transmission bit rates.
